Mumbai, Maharashtra, India, October 2025 — Ajay More has been elevated to Head HR – Global Business Services (GBS) at Sodexo, marking a key milestone in his remarkable journey with the organization. In his new role, Ajay will lead the people and culture strategy for Sodexo’s GBS operations, driving strategic HR initiatives, enhancing employee experience, and steering organizational transformation aligned with Sodexo’s global vision of service excellence and sustainability.
With a career spanning more than 18 years across facilities management, real estate, manufacturing, and telecom infrastructure, Ajay brings a deep understanding of talent development, performance management, and organizational restructuring. Since joining Sodexo in 2018, he has played a pivotal role in strengthening the company’s human capital framework, fostering a high-engagement culture, and championing leadership development initiatives that have reinforced Sodexo’s position as an employer of choice.
Before his elevation, Ajay served as AVP – Human Resources at Sodexo, where he successfully managed strategic hiring, budgeting, HR transformation, and succession planning across diverse business units. Previously, he was associated with JLL India, PE Electronics Ltd., American Tower Corporation, and ESS DEE Aluminium, where he led initiatives in employee engagement, people analytics, and performance improvement. About Sodexo
Founded in Marseille in 1966 by Pierre Bellon, Sodexo is the global leader in sustainable food and valued experiences across education, healthcare, corporate, and lifestyle environments. Operating in more than 50 countries, the Group provides food and facilities management services that enhance quality of life for millions daily.
With a mission to “create a better everyday for everyone to build a better life for all,” Sodexo integrates innovation, inclusivity, and sustainability into every aspect of its business. The company’s commitment to social progress and environmental stewardship is reflected in its inclusion in indices such as CAC 40 ESG, Bloomberg France 40, and DJSI.
